Trams and Trains

As the global economy grapples with the twin challenges of economic contraction and diminishing fossil fuel energy availability, the role of public transportation systems, particularly trams and trains, has come into sharp focus. Long considered sustainable alternatives to individual car ownership, trams and trains offer a lifeline for communities striving to reduce their carbon footprint and adapt to a world of dwindling resources.

Trams, with their fixed routes and efficient electric propulsion systems, represent a particularly promising mode of public transportation in an era of shrinking economies and reduced energy availability. Unlike cars, which rely heavily on fossil fuels and contribute significantly to air pollution and greenhouse gas emissions, trams offer a cleaner, greener alternative that is well-suited to the challenges of a carbon-constrained world.

One of the key advantages of trams is their ability to transport large numbers of passengers efficiently along dedicated tracks, reducing congestion and cutting travel times in densely populated urban areas. By providing a reliable and affordable means of transportation, trams help to alleviate the economic burden of car ownership for individuals and families struggling to make ends meet in a shrinking economy.

Moreover, trams have the potential to revitalize local economies by connecting residents to employment opportunities, educational institutions, and commercial centers. As businesses adapt to the realities of reduced consumer spending and energy constraints, the accessibility offered by tram networks can help to attract customers and support economic activity in city centers and suburban areas alike.

Similarly, trains play a critical role in sustainable transportation systems, offering long-distance travel options that are both efficient and environmentally friendly. With their ability to move large volumes of passengers and freight over vast distances, trains represent a low-carbon alternative to air and road transportation, particularly for intercity and interstate travel.

In addition to their environmental benefits, trains offer economic advantages that are especially relevant in times of economic uncertainty. By reducing reliance on imported fossil fuels and minimizing the costs associated with road maintenance and congestion, trains help to conserve financial resources and strengthen local economies. Moreover, investments in rail infrastructure create jobs and stimulate economic growth, providing a much-needed boost to communities grappling with high unemployment and stagnating wages.

However, the widespread adoption of trams and trains faces significant challenges, particularly in regions where car culture is deeply ingrained and public transportation infrastructure is lacking. In many parts of the world, decades of underinvestment in public transportation have left communities reliant on cars for mobility, perpetuating a cycle of dependence on fossil fuels and exacerbating the environmental and economic consequences of transportation emissions.

Moreover, the transition to tram and train-based transportation systems requires substantial upfront investments in infrastructure, technology, and workforce training, posing a barrier to implementation in cash-strapped municipalities and regions. Without adequate funding and political will, efforts to expand public transportation networks and promote modal shifts away from cars are likely to falter, perpetuating the status quo of car-centric urban planning and unsustainable transportation practices.
